Many people have heard of Kung Fu. You may be picturing an animated Panda eating noodles, and I do approve, but you may not know the irony of that. ‘Fu’ directly translates to ‘way’ or ‘method’. ‘Kung’ means hard, physical, or effort.

Kung Fu = Physical Method

Not many people learn Gung Fu. Gung denotes a possession and refers to self or mind. Fu stays the same.

Gung Fu = Mental (Your) Method
